Read more »Accredited since 2003, AGS Frasers Ghana recently passed FIDI’s latest auditing standards and was awarded the FIDI-FAIMPLUS accreditation. Rated with extremely high compliance to the strict FAIM standards, the company joins an elite group of top performers in 2016. This achievement coincides with the branch’s 20th anniversary operating in Ghana.

AGS Four Winds Thailand sponsored a two-piano recital with world-renowned pianist, Vladimir Ashkenazy and his son Vovka, who performed in front of a vibrant audience in Bangkok, Thailand. This once in a lifetime event took place on Saturday, 14 May at the Thailand Cultural Center and attracted classical music lovers from all over the country.

AGS Four Winds Singapore has once again participated and supported the French Chamber of Commerce in Singapore by being the main sponsor of the popular Pétanque Tournament. Pétanque, which attracts both young and old, is a game where metallic balls must be thrown as close as possible to a small wooden ball called a cochonnet.
